Ed Robins

Director
  • Location:
    New South Wales
  • Services:
    Quantity Surveying
  • Qualifications:
    BCPM (Hons), MAIQS, CQS
  • Connect:
    • [email protected]
    • (02) 9270 1000
    • LinkedIn

Ed is a prominent leader in MBM’s quantity surveying division backed by a comprehensive career and multiple sector specialisations.

As a Director in MBM?’s Quantity Surveying division and with over a decade of experience, Ed leads projects to success with a focus on risk mitigation through precision-driven cost management. Ed’s engagement with diverse public and private sector clients informs his in-depth understanding of industry specific risks, challenges, and intricacies in complex high value projects. Working with subject matter experts across the business, Ed’s strategic approach encompasses a holistic evaluation of project inputs and constraints, an analysis of lessons learnt, and close consultation with MBM’s Director team to ensure the highest quality of pre and post contract service delivery.

Throughout projects of all scales and scopes, Ed builds strong client relationships to determine where value can be added. He ensures all critical stakeholders remain informed through considered risk modelling to support optimal strategic decision making. Ed is a Certified Quantity Surveyor (CQS) and graduated with a Bachelor of Construction Project Management from the University of Technology Sydney with First Class Honours. He was notably awarded the Master Builders Association (MBA) Best Student Estimator of the Year award and has been a long-time Member of the Australian Institute of Quantity Surveyors (MAIQS).
